Akpabio As Senate President Will Engender Genuine Unity – Eka

by Achor Abimaje
2 years ago
in News
Share on WhatsAppShare on FacebookShare on XTelegram

 

Advertisement

A former House of Representatives aspirant for Itu / Ibiono Ibom Federal Constituency in Akwa Ibom State under the platform of the Peoples Democratic Party (PDP) Dr. Nsikak Eka has said the choice of Senator Godswill Akpabio for the position of senate president by the president-elect Asiwaju Bola Tinubu as a patriotic one that will further engender genuine unity in the country.

Eka while addressing newsmen in Jos yesterday said this is even as the vice president-elect, Senator Kashim Shettima, had explained the rationale behind the decision, which was chiefly, among other things, to avoid a situation whereby the number one citizen, number two citizen, the number three citizen and the number four citizen are all of the same faith.

“With careful observations, Asiwaju Bola Tinubu did not make a mistake for settling for Akpabio to balance the political equation of the country based on the religious and geopolitical entity. The former governor and chairman of the NDDC has an unrivaled track record that has placed him in the proper position to keep contributing positively to national unity and development,” he said.

Dr. Eka while laying credence to his view on a modern-driven system that will stimulate the push for change and drive an all-inclusive administration that will create a meaningful impact on the people, advised Nigerians to support the incoming administration because, according to him, “there is light at the end of the tunnel.”
